Terrible accident Monday morning on the B3 in Mauthausen (Upper Austria). At 10:30 a.m. emergency services were called to a serious accident involving three vehicles. All help came too late for the Hungarian driver (24) of a van.
For unknown reasons, a car, a taxi and a truck collided. The emergency services were deployed with a large contingent consisting of two fire brigades, several ambulances, an ambulance and the police. Despite the swift arrival, the Hungarian driver (24) of the van died at the accident site. The driver of the truck (52) and the passenger of the taxi (62) were injured and were taken to hospitals.
The road was closed for more than three hours
Hummer had to be requested for the clean-up work. They took care of the road transport of the truck and a sweeper was also used to remove the dirt from the road as quickly as possible. The B3 was closed until the early afternoon.
